Introduction to Policy and Advocacy in Gerontology

GERON 577 - Class Number: 14482

Historical Perspectives Human Diversity within the U.S.

Description:

Covers the history of and current aging policy in the U.S. with topics including: formal and informal caregiving, healthcare, retirement, elder abuse, minority rights, and current movements in aging policy. Focuses on advocacy and policy analysis. Students will formulate, apply, and express their point of view through discussions and integrative projects.
